98 S70 GLT Key Spin

Post by TheSwede »

About two weeks ago my key started spinning in the ignition. I searched the site and as usual, it seems to be a fairly common problem. I went to the stealership and ordered the mechanical portion of the ignition. The spinning got so bad, I was almost stranded a couple times. I sprayed some WD-40 in where you would insert the key and since then (about 50 start cycles) I haven't had the key spin at all. I'm going to install the mechanical part of the ignition in any case, but is my problem more likely the electrical portion and the WD-40 just cleaned it up a little bit? Anyone experience something similar?
